Car Key Replacement Cost

Replacing your car key can be expensive. You may be able to get the cost replacement car key of replacing your car keys covered by a Key Protection Cover, which you can purchase as an addition to your insurance plan or as a separate item.

The cost of replacing your car keys varies according to the year the model, make and year of your vehicle. In this article we will examine the factors that affect the cost of replacement car keys.

The Make and Model of Your Vehicle

It's always a headache to lose your car keys however, it's a lot more troublesome when you don’t have spare keys. In the majority of cases, when you want to drive your car again you'll require a new set of keys. However, the key for your car replacement cost can vary significantly depending on your specific vehicle. Modern cars come with a broad array of features that can increase the cost of replacing your keys. For example sports cars with high performance often have specialized keys that are expensive to duplicate.

In addition the older mechanical keys also tend to be more expensive to reproduce because they require the expertise of a dealer to work. Therefore, it's essential to know your car's model and make before requesting a quote from a locksmith or automotive dealership. This allows you to get an accurate estimate of the cost.

The complexity of your key system can impact the price. Modern key fobs, for example include a circuit and battery that make them more difficult to replace than previous car keys.

Some car owners visit the dealer to duplicate their car keys because they believe it's cheaper. The dealership will likely charge a premium price for their services. This is because the dealership's primary goal is to earn profits from their customers.

You may want to consider employing a third-party company to replace your car keys if you are unable to afford it at the dealership. They may be able offer you a better price than the dealer, and have a team with more experience to assist you replace your car keys.

It is also important to note that it's best to avoid hardware stores or companies that are third party to have your keys duplicated. These companies aren't likely to have the experience required to accurately duplicate your car keys, and they are also more likely to alter your original keys or create an inferior replacement keys for cars.

The Automotive Locksmith You Use

If you've ever had to lock your keys to your car it's a hassle that which no one would like to face. It's a situation that usually occurs at the worst moment, such as when you're running late for an important meeting or event. If you're in search of a quick and affordable solution, you should call an auto locksmith instead of going to the dealership.

Car keys and FOBs are miniature electronic devices that contain circuitry and have a special transponder chip that has to be programmed in order to allow them to be able to start the car. In the past, these chips were installed in the ignition cylinder however, as technology improved and the chips were repositioned, they were placed on the key fobs. Key fobs were upgraded to be more secure and harder to duplicate. However the cost of repairs and replacements increased due to the fact that the new key fobs needed to be programmed either by an automotive locksmith or by a dealer.

Fortunately, a lot of locksmiths for cars have learned and adapted to handle these newer systems. They can program the new FOBs to work with your vehicle, and even remove old ones that won't work. The cost of this service will differ according to the year, make, and model of your vehicle.

The type of key you need will also affect the price. The majority of vehicles have two kinds of keys: a conventional metal fob that's not attached to the ignition or any other electrical component. The second is a remote key that locks and unlocks the doors. The former is the easiest to replace since it doesn't require programming and can easily be cut by an auto locksmith using the blank.

It is more expensive to replace the transponder key because it is required to unlock the car. It's vital to use a trusted locksmith to replace your key when you need one. If you attempt to do it yourself, or make use of tools such as coat hangers, you may harm the lock and the key may not work.

What type of key do you need?

There are many different types of car keys. Some keys are mechanical, and must be inserted directly into the ignition cylinder. Others contain transponders that are able to unlock doors and start the engine remotely. The cost of replacing the latter is higher, as it requires programming by a professional to your vehicle. Luckily, locksmiths have adapted to the latest technology, and you don't need to visit a dealership to have one of these keys.

It's not fun to lose or smuggle your keys, but it can be even more difficult when you find yourself not able to start your car and have no where to go. In the past, it was easy to find a replacement key in any hardware store, or even at your car dealership. However, with the introduction of modern security features and the ease of stealing cars by remote control, it's not so easy to find a solution.

You can try tracking the keys yourself by searching online groups or contacting the dealer, but that's not always the best option. Most dealers are only able to make a replacement key for your vehicle after you bring it in, and they'll charge you for this service. It's also worth looking into whether the cost of replacing the key is covered by your warranty, roadside assistance coverage or bumper-to-bumper insurance.

If you need to replace your mechanical key it is possible to do this for a relatively low price if you only require cutting one. The majority of locksmiths in the automotive industry can duplicate them for less than $10, although you might require more for older models that do not utilize transponder chips.

The most expensive option for a replacement car key is to visit the dealership. This is the most efficient option if you have the original key to show them, but otherwise, it's not worth the hassle, particularly in the event that your insurance company covers the cost. If you decide to go this route, be sure to research and compare prices between dealerships and third-party key experts.

The Location

Car keys are electronic devices that have batteries and circuitry. They also have transmitters that can send an encoded code to start the car and open the doors. They can be expensive to replace in the event that they break or are lost. The key itself costs very little however the time and effort required to program it for your car could be very costly. These costs can vary widely depending on the kind and degree of complexity of the key as well as the locksmith or dealer you select to cut it.

The location of your house can affect the cost of the purchase of a new car key. If you reside in rural areas, there may be fewer locksmiths in the automotive industry to help you. You might have to pay more for services if you live in a rural area since they will need to travel further to reach you. If you reside in Chicago you'll have numerous options for locksmiths for your automobile. You can choose a locksmith that is priced competitively.

In some instances you can save money by replacing the battery in your key fob for your car. The majority of drivers can do this if they adhere to the owner's manual for their vehicle. Some companies that sell car keys can even provide this for free, however it is a good idea to confirm the warranty on your car before you do this.

If you lost your car key and don't have a spare, the best solution is to go to a dealer in your area and get a new one that is paired with your vehicle. This is the most expensive, but also the most reliable option.
